KENTUCKY REAL ESTATE COM'N v. MILGROM

Nos. 2004-CA-001513-MR, 2004-CA-001540-MR.

197 S.W.3d 552 (2005)

KENTUCKY REAL ESTATE COMMISSION and David L. Jones, Appellants, v. Aaron MILGROM, Appellee, and David L. Jones and Kentucky Real Estate Commission, Appellants, v. Aaron Milgrom, Appellee.

Court of Appeals of Kentucky.

Discretionary Review Denied by Supreme Court August 17, 2006.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Geraldine Lee B. Harris, Louisville, KY, for appellant Kentucky Real Estate Commission.

Richard E. Vimont, Lexington, KY, for appellant David L. Jones.

John B. Park, Lexington, KY, for appellee.

Before MINTON, SCHRODER, and TAYLOR, Judges.


OPINION

SCHRODER, Judge.

These are two appeals from an opinion and order reversing a decision of the Kentucky Real Estate Commission ("KREC") disciplining a broker licensee/buyer for failing to set up and retain certain funds in an escrow account and for misrepresenting that he had a line of credit and was holding the funds in an escrow account. The circuit court held that the KREC did not have the statutory authority to discipline the licensee/buyer...
